Veterinary hospitals represent one of the largest application segments for veterinary radiography acquisition systems. These facilities typically provide comprehensive care for a wide range of animals, including pets, wildlife, and farm animals. Diagnostic imaging is essential in these settings for identifying fractures, infections, tumors, and other medical conditions that may require surgical intervention or long-term management. The demand for high-quality imaging systems in veterinary hospitals is fueled by an increasing awareness of the importance of precise diagnostic tools in treating animals. Furthermore, advancements in digital radiography, which offer faster image acquisition and clearer results, are driving veterinary hospitals to adopt more sophisticated radiographic technologies.
As veterinary hospitals continue to expand and offer more specialized services, the need for reliable and advanced radiographic systems is growing. Modern veterinary hospitals focus on improving patient outcomes by using the latest diagnostic equipment, including radiography systems. The growing trend towards pet ownership and a rising focus on animal health are expected to further contribute to the demand for these systems in veterinary hospital settings. In addition, the integration of cloud-based data management systems and the ability to access diagnostic results remotely are becoming increasingly important for veterinary hospitals, making digital radiography systems more desirable. Overall, veterinary hospitals are likely to remain a key driver of growth in the veterinary radiography acquisition system market.
Aid organizations play a critical role in animal welfare, especially in disaster-stricken areas, shelters, or underdeveloped regions where access to veterinary care might be limited. These organizations often utilize veterinary radiography acquisition systems to provide rapid and accurate diagnostics for injured or sick animals. The need for mobile and portable radiography units is especially prevalent in these environments, where aid workers must quickly assess the health status of animals in challenging conditions. Aid organizations rely on these systems to detect injuries, diseases, and parasites in both domestic and wild animals, which is crucial for providing timely treatment or rescue efforts.
The role of aid organizations in promoting animal health is increasingly vital, particularly as global awareness about animal rights and welfare grows. These organizations help to bridge the gap in veterinary care, especially in rural or underserved regions. As veterinary radiography technology becomes more affordable and accessible, aid organizations are increasingly able to deploy advanced diagnostic tools in their fieldwork. This allows them to deliver better healthcare and support for animals that would otherwise not have access to professional veterinary care. Consequently, the application of veterinary radiography systems within aid organizations is expanding, contributing to the broader development of animal health initiatives worldwide.
The "Others" segment encompasses various applications of veterinary radiography acquisition systems beyond veterinary hospitals and aid organizations. This includes research institutions, zoos, wildlife rehabilitation centers, and private veterinary clinics. Each of these sectors relies on veterinary radiography to ensure the health and well-being of animals under their care. For example, research institutions utilize radiography systems to conduct studies on animal anatomy, diseases, and treatment outcomes, further advancing scientific knowledge in veterinary medicine. Zoos and wildlife rehabilitation centers, on the other hand, use these systems to monitor the health of exotic and endangered species, supporting conservation efforts.
The "Others" category also includes mobile veterinary services and veterinary practices that operate outside traditional hospital settings. As more veterinarians move toward providing at-home care, portable radiography systems are becoming increasingly popular, as they allow professionals to perform diagnostics remotely. This flexibility in application broadens the scope of veterinary radiography systems, creating opportunities for growth in niche areas within the veterinary industry. The continued evolution of veterinary practices and the growing emphasis on animal welfare in diverse settings ensure that the "Others" application segment will continue to play a significant role in shaping the overall veterinary radiography acquisition system market.

One of the key trends in the veterinary radiography acquisition system market is the ongoing shift towards digital radiography systems. Digital systems offer several advantages over traditional film-based systems, including faster image acquisition, improved image quality, and the ability to store and share images electronically. This transition to digital technology is not only improving the efficiency of veterinary care but also making it easier for veterinarians to collaborate with other professionals and access patient data remotely. Furthermore, digital systems are becoming more affordable, enabling even smaller veterinary clinics and mobile veterinary services to invest in these advanced technologies.
Another significant trend is the increasing adoption of portable and mobile radiography systems. Veterinarians are seeking flexible solutions that allow them to conduct diagnostic imaging in various settings, from animal shelters to farm fields. Portable radiography equipment offers the convenience of on-site imaging, reducing the need for animals to be transported to veterinary hospitals for diagnostics. This trend is expected to grow as more veterinarians adopt mobile practices and as aid organizations and emergency response teams require portable diagnostic tools for fieldwork. The mobility and versatility of these systems are likely to continue driving innovation and demand in the veterinary radiography acquisition system market.

1. What is veterinary radiography?
Veterinary radiography is the process of using X-ray technology to create images of the internal structures of animals for diagnostic purposes.
2. How does veterinary radiography benefit animal health?
Veterinary radiography helps in diagnosing fractures, tumors, infections, and other internal issues in animals, aiding in timely treatment and care.
3. What are the advantages of digital veterinary radiography?
Digital veterinary radiography offers faster image acquisition, higher image quality, and easier storage and sharing of images compared to traditional film-based systems.
4. Are portable radiography systems available for veterinarians?
Yes, portable veterinary radiography systems are available and allow veterinarians to perform diagnostic imaging on-site, particularly in mobile practices or field settings.
5. What are the major applications of veterinary radiography systems?
The major applications include veterinary hospitals, aid organizations, private clinics, zoos, wildlife rehabilitation centers, and research institutions.
6. What factors drive the demand for veterinary radiography systems?
Factors include the increasing pet ownership, advancements in radiography technology, and the rising demand for accurate diagnostic tools in veterinary practices.
7. How is veterinary radiography used in emergency situations?
In emergency situations, veterinary radiography is used to quickly diagnose injuries, fractures, and internal bleeding in animals, enabling rapid treatment.
8. What are the benefits of mobile veterinary radiography systems?
Mobile veterinary radiography systems offer convenience, allowing veterinarians to perform diagnostic imaging on animals at remote locations or in emergency situations.
